本篇文章给大家谈谈***是原生开发嘛,以及***是原生开发嘛怎么弄对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、APP是怎样被开发出来的
- 2、原生开发的app有哪些
- 3、APP和原生APP的区别
***是怎样被开发出来的
第一步:需求分析,包括了解用户的需要的开发平台、具体产品功能需求、具体的产品设计需求、项目期望完成时间、开发预算等 第二步:需求评估,包括评估功能需求技术难度、设计需求可行性与体验、项目预期完成时间、实际开发费用。
以前的开发流程就是工程师从头写到尾,把***功能全部开发完成后再进行系统测试,这样就很容易出现以下几个问题:修改了一处bug却在另一处地方引发了新的bug、扩展新功能的同时导致旧代码出现bug等等,这个时候就需要引入单元测试。
从最初与客户了解需求功能到最终的测试上线,一个完整的***就被开发出来了。
常见的开发流程是:商业***书→市场调研→用户调研→需求说明书→产品基础原型设计→程序开发→UI/UE设计→测试→内容填充→最小可行性产品上线→产品运营→功能持续迭代→稳定产品阶段。
开发一款***需要经过以下步骤:确定***的开发目标和需求:在开始开发***之前,需要明确***的开发目标、功能需求、用户群体等,以便为后续的开发过程提供指导。
原生开发的***有哪些
Instagram、Uber。Instagram:用于分享照片和***的社交媒体平台。Uber:提供出租车和私人汽车服务的应用程序。
⊙这里可没有标准的SDK,基本任意选择别忘了有一些跨平台的开发工具,比如PhoneGap,SenchaTouch2,***can以及Titanium等等。
原生***开发是指使用特定平台的原生开发语言和工具,如iOS平台的Objective-C或Swift语言、Android平台的J***a语言等,开发出适用于特定操作系统的***应用程序。
开发***的软件有很多,每个软件都有其自身的优点和适用范围,以下是一些常见的开发***的软件:Android Studio:这是谷歌官方推出的用于开发Android应用的集成开发环境(IDE),基于IntelliJ IDEA,支持J***a和Kotlin两种编程语言。
Phone的***开发是C##语言。如今市面上多数的***软件开发都是使用的原生程序编写的应用程序,也就是说大部分的手机***属于原生***应用软件。
***和原生***的区别
1、原生型***应用的安装包相对较大,包含UI元素、资料内容、逻辑框架; 手机使用者无法上网也可访问***应用中以前下载的资料。
2、开发方面有区别:(1)原生***:每一种移动操作系统都需要独立的开发项目,iphone版本、Ipad版本、安卓版本。每种平台都需要独立的开发语言。J***a(Android),Objective-C(iOS)等等。
3、原生型***应用的安装包相对较大,包含UI元素、数据内容、逻辑框架;手机用户无法上网也可访问***应用中以前下载的数据。
4、功能更强大 从以上定义中可以看出,原生***是系统性的应用程序,可以地用手机终端的硬件设备,比如语音、短信、GPS、蓝牙、重力感应和摄像头等,但是web***是不可以做到这些的。
5、原生移动应用开发和源生移动应用开发的区别 可以找到 手机***(移动应用)的区别 手机***,通常认为是游戏***和应用***。也就是手机***包括了移动应用。手机***另外还包含了服务类的应用,即没有用户界面的***。
关于***是原生开发嘛和***是原生开发嘛怎么弄的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。